Rule 30I now use an LED version of the hurricane lamp, which is whiter and seems brighter, no need to carry seperate fuel and a set of D batteries last a long time, I've yet to exhaust a set. When I first started sailing (more years ago than I like to remember) my instructor said that, a hurricane lamp, whilst not strictly conforming with the collregs neither did the price! If suspended above the foredeck the mast will obscure part of the arc so it's not an "all round" light. On the plus point I think that a light at about eye level of an approaching vessel is more readily seen than one at the top of the mast many more feet up in the air - only my opinion of course.
